Wendy’s is bringing the Baconator experience to your fridge. The fast food giant has quietly rolled out a new line of grocery products, including its signature double-smoked bacon and square burger patties, now available in select Kroger and King Soopers locations.

Spotted first in Kentucky, Ohio, and Colorado, the new retail items are being marketed as “restaurant-inspired,” with thick-cut bacon and one-pound packs of “fresh, never frozen” burger patties. While Wendy’s hasn’t confirmed if these match their in-store ingredients exactly, the move is part of a test to gauge consumer demand outside the drive-thru.

This product expansion follows its recently announced Baconator-flavored Cheez-IT, Frosty Flavors with Pop-Tarts and OREO Mixes, and Frosty Swirls and Frosty Fusions.

Fan response is already split. Some are eager to recreate Baconators at home while others are skeptical of what they deem to be essentially branded bacon. Either way, it’s clear Wendy’s is thinking beyond the counter.
